Alfred Okou (born 3 September 1963) is a former Ivorian rugby union player. He played as a flanker.

He played for Stade Poitevin Rugby in France.

Okou had 7 caps for Ivory Coast, from 1993 to 1995, scoring 1 try, 5 points in aggregate- He was called for the 1995 Rugby World Cup, playing in all the three games and scoring the single try of his career.
